Best Wireless Backup Camera For Trucks Buying Guide: What to Look for Before You Buy
1. Wired vs. Wireless Signal Transmission
One of the first decisions you will face when shopping for the best wireless backup camera for trucks is whether to go wired or wireless. Wired systems like the LeeKooLuu LK3 offer the most stable signal transmission because the video travels through a physical cable rather than through the air. This means zero interference, no dropped frames, and consistent image quality on bumpy backroads or highways. If you do not mind running a cable from your rear camera to your cab-mounted monitor, a wired system is hard to beat on reliability alone.
Wireless systems have made massive strides in recent years thanks to digital 2.4GHz transmission technology. Most of the wireless models in our lineup claim a stable range of 33 to 36 feet within a vehicle, which is plenty for standard pickups and even many tow setups. However, metal trailer walls, aftermarket hitches, and interference from other electronics can still challenge weaker wireless chipsets. Look for systems that specify digital wireless transmission rather than analog, and pay attention to whether the brand has upgraded its chipset recently for better anti-interference performance.

2. Camera Resolution and Night Vision Quality
Resolution matters, but it is not the only number to watch. Most modern backup cameras in our lineup offer HD 1080P resolution, which delivers sharp, detailed images during daylight hours. The real differentiator between a mediocre and an excellent camera is how it performs at night or in low-light conditions like dawn, dusk, rain, or a dimly lit parking garage.
Look for cameras equipped with infrared (IR) LED lights and a low lumen rating. A camera rated at 0.1 lumens, like the AUTO-VOX CS-2 with its PC1058 sensor, can produce a usable image in near-total darkness. The pemacom P15 takes this further with a self-developed algorithm that the brand claims improves image clarity by approximately 80 percent compared to standard chipsets, along with its CMOS image sensor that actively suppresses glare and restores true color at night.
Wide-angle lenses are also critical for trucks and trailers. Most cameras in our lineup offer between 110 and 170 degrees of viewing angle. A 150-degree angle strikes a practical balance between a wide field of view and minimal image distortion at the edges. Wider angles beyond 170 degrees tend to introduce fish-eye distortion that can make judging distances harder, not easier.
3. Installation Type and Ease of Setup
How you install your backup camera system will largely depend on your truck setup and how often you want to move the camera. Traditional wireless systems like the AMTIFO W70 and the DoHonest V29 connect the camera to your truck's reverse or running lights and power the monitor via a cigarette lighter adapter. Setup typically takes under 30 minutes and requires no drilling. These are excellent for permanent or semi-permanent installations on a single vehicle.
Magnetic mount systems represent the newest generation of backup camera technology and are the fastest to install by far. The DVKNM AP7, AMTIFO A26, DoHonest V35, and pemacom P15 all use strong rare-earth magnets to attach directly to any metal surface on your truck or trailer. The pemacom P15 specifically uses third-generation NdFeB rare-earth permanent magnets rated to withstand temperatures up to 630 degrees Celsius without demagnetizing. This matters for truck owners who park in direct sun or operate in hot climates where a weaker magnet could eventually lose its grip.
If you regularly hitch different trailers or need to reposition your camera frequently, a magnetic system saves significant time. Just be aware that non-metal trailer components like fiberglass RV bodies will not work with a magnetic mount without an adhesive metal plate adapter.
4. Power Source and Battery Life
Power is a surprisingly important consideration, especially for wireless systems. Traditional systems draw power from the cigarette lighter or vehicle ignition, which means they only work when the truck is running. Solar-powered models with built-in rechargeable batteries offer much more flexibility, particularly for trailer and RV applications where you may not have a convenient power tap near the camera location.
The pemacom P15 leads the pack here with a 15,000mAh lithium-ion battery and a bundled 5W solar panel, delivering up to 24 hours of continuous use on a single charge. The DVKNM AP7 and DoHonest V35 each feature 9,600mAh batteries with dual solar and Type-C charging. AMTIFO's A26 also carries a 9,600mAh battery and adds voice control for hands-free monitor activation, so you never have to take your eyes off the road to wake the screen.
For everyday urban and suburban driving, a standard cigarette-lighter-powered wireless system is perfectly adequate. For long-haul trucking, horse trailer hauling, or fifth-wheel camping trips, a solar rechargeable system is a much smarter investment that eliminates the need to think about power at all.

6. Waterproofing and Durability Standards
Your backup camera will live outside, exposed to rain, road spray, mud, and extreme temperature swings. Do not settle for anything rated below IP68. The top models in our lineup, including the DoHonest V35, AMTIFO W70, and AUTO-VOX CS-2, carry IP69 or IP69K ratings, which means they are tested against high-pressure, high-temperature water jets, not just rainfall. This is the commercial-grade standard used in agricultural and industrial equipment and is genuinely overkill in the best possible way for truck and trailer applications.
Temperature range is equally important. A camera that stops working in a Wisconsin winter or an Arizona summer is useless. Most models in our lineup are rated from negative 4 to 149 degrees Fahrenheit, while the LeeKooLuu LK3 extends that range to negative 22 to 176 degrees Fahrenheit, which covers virtually any climate in the continental United States. 7. DVR Recording and Dual-Channel Support
Not every truck driver needs DVR functionality, but for commercial operators, long-haul truckers, or anyone who wants video evidence in the event of an accident, it is a genuinely valuable feature. The pemacom P15 and DVKNM AP7 both include loop-recording DVR systems that can automatically overwrite old footage while protecting impact-triggered clips. The P15 supports up to a 128GB SD card, while the AP7 includes a 32GB card in the box.
Dual-channel support, which allows you to connect a second camera to the same monitor, is another feature worth prioritizing if you tow a long trailer or want both a hitch view and a license plate view simultaneously. The AMTIFO W70, AMTIFO A6, DoHonest V35, and pemacom P15 all support two camera inputs, giving you maximum coverage without needing a second monitor system. For truck and trailer setups, this can be the difference between a confident lane change and a costly mistake.
